What Does Bruising And Yellow Discoloration Around A Rope Burn Indicate?

I was tubing the other day and I fell off in front of the tube so I was dragged in between the rope and the tube for about 2 seconds. I think I got severe rope burn on my lower left belly, it s been 3 days now and I woke up today with a bulge along that line of rope burn, it doesn t bother me but the area is yellow and bruised?

It can be subcutaneous capillaries giving way leading to blue, yellow, green discoloration of an intact skin. It would heal over time & needs ice bag application to hasten the process. Other possibility of buried & cut skin getting infected, inflamed with pus formation. Here there would be pain, fever along with other symptoms & needs antibiotic. Consult your family physician for actual local examination & decision.
